Lettuce and Chicory Price in Spain (FOB) - 2023

The average lettuce and chicory export price stood at $1,534 per ton in August 2023, shrinking by -7.8% against the previous month. In general, the export price showed a relatively flat trend pattern.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in February 2023 when the average export price increased by 29% against the previous month. Over the period under review, the average export prices reached the maximum at $1,663 per ton in July 2023, and then dropped in the following month.

There were significant differences in the average prices for the major overseas markets. In August 2023, the country with the highest price was the Netherlands ($2,609 per ton), while the average price for exports to Poland ($1,000 per ton) was amongst the lowest.

From August 2022 to August 2023,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was recorded for supplies to Sweden (+2.3%), while the prices for the other major destinations experienced more modest paces of growth.

Lettuce and Chicory Price in Spain (CIF) - 2023

The average lettuce and chicory import price stood at $1,822 per ton in August 2023, growing by 8.5% against the previous month. Over the last twelve-month period, it increased at an average monthly rate of +2.1%.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in October 2022 an increase of 16% m-o-m. The import price peaked at $2,286 per ton in February 2023; however, from March 2023 to August 2023, import prices stood at a somewhat lower figure.

There were significant differences in the average prices amongst the major supplying countries. In August 2023, the country with the highest price was France ($2,355 per ton), while the price for Germany ($720 per ton) was amongst the lowest.

From August 2022 to August 2023,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by Belgium (+2.7%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ced more modest paces of growth.

Lettuce and Chicory Exports in Spain

In 2022, shipments abroad of lettuce and chicory decreased by -8.5% to 791K tons for the first time since 2018, thus ending a three-year rising trend. Over the period under review, exports recorded a mild reduction.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2021 when exports increased by 3.8% against the previous year. As a result, the exports attained the peak of 864K tons, and then reduced in the following year.

In value terms, lettuce and chicory exports contracted to $981M in 2022. The total export value increased at an average annual rate of +3.6% from 2019 to 2022; the trend pattern remained relatively stable, with only minor fluctuations being observed in certain years.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2021 with an increase of 21% against the previous year. As a result, the exports reached the peak of $1B, and then reduced in the following year.

Top Export Markets for Lettuce and Chicory from Spain in 2022:

  1. Germany (188.5K tons)
  2. France (143.3K tons)
  3. United Kingdom (127.2K tons)
  4. Italy (71.3K tons)
  5. Netherlands (63.3K tons)
  6. Poland (39.5K tons)
  7. Sweden (26.9K tons)
  8. Austria (13.6K tons)
  9. Denmark (13.5K tons)
  10. Czech Republic (13.3K tons)
  11. Switzerland (12.4K tons)
  12. Finland (12.1K tons)

Lettuce and Chicory Imports in Spain

In 2022, imports of lettuce and chicory into Spain expanded markedly to 30K tons, with an increase of 6.7% on 2021 figures. The total import volume increased at an average annual rate of +8.9% over the period from 2019 to 2022; however, the trend pattern ind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ded in certain years.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2021 with an increase of 24% against the previous year. Over the period under review, imports reached the maximum in 2022 and are expected to retain growth in years to come.

In value terms, lettuce and chicory imports expanded remarkably to $49M in 2022. In general, total imports indicated a buoyant increase from 2019 to 2022: its value increased at an average annual rate of +15.1% over the last three-year period.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2022 figures, imports increased by +52.5% against 2019 indices.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2021 with an increase of 29% against the previous year. Over the period under review, imports reached the maximum in 2022 and are expected to retain growth in years to come.

Top Suppliers of Lettuce and Chicory to Spain in 2022:

  1. France (10.3K tons)
  2. Netherlands (6.2K tons)
  3. Italy (4.6K tons)
  4. Belgium (4.1K tons)
  5. Portugal (3.5K tons)
  6. Germany (1.0K tons)
